In a marine propulsion control system for controlling a set of propulsion units carried by a hull of a vessel, cavitation typically occurs on the propulsion unit with reverse gear engaged, and in a triple propulsion unit installation the normally idle center propulsion unit can be used to increase the reverse thrust and thereby limit the RPM of propulsion units in reverse, so that the cavitation effect is limited, and simultaneously allow for higher forward thrust on the third propulsion unit, thus increasing the total thrust for the vessel. |

A marine propulsion control system for controlling a set of propulsion units carried by a hull of a vessel, wherein the set of propulsion units comprise a first propulsion unit, a second propulsion unit and a third propulsion unit, wherein the second propulsion unit is provided as a center propulsion unit between the first and third propulsion unit, the marine propulsion control system comprising a control unit configured to:
receive an input command from a steering control instrument for operating the vessel; determine a desired delivered thrust, gear selection and steering angle for the first, second and third propulsion unit respectively, based on the input command, and provide a set of control commands for controlling the desired delivered thrust, gear selection and steering angle for the first, second and third propulsion unit, wherein if the input command indicates a sway command the first propulsion unit is set to have a forward gear selection and the third propulsion unit is set to have a reverse gear selection, each with a selected thrust level, and if the thrust level for at least one of the first and the third propulsion unit exceeds a predetermined thrust level the second propulsion unit is set to have a reverse gear selection with a thrust level depending on the selected thrust level of at least one of the first and the third propulsion unit. |
